Question 150: To ask the Tánaiste and Minister for Enterprise, Trade and Employment if she will report on her meeting with the chief executive officer of an airline (details supplied); if she discussed the issue of this airline's proposal to axe 18 of its services from their Shannon schedule commencing in March 2010; if Shannon Airport was discussed as an alternative site for this airline's aircraft maintenance facility; and if she will make a statement on the matter. [8889/10]
Mary Coughlan (Donegal South West, Fianna Fail)
Link to this: Individually | In context
I met Mr. O'Leary on 16 February, at his request, to discuss proposals for aircraft maintenance jobs at Dublin Airport. While a number of alternatives were put to Mr. O'Leary with regard to the hangar needs of Ryanair, Mr. O'Leary was adamant that only hanger 6 at Dublin Airport could meet Ryanair's needs. Following the meeting with Ryanair, I met the chairman and CEO of Shannon Development on 17 February. They outlined their intention to propose to Ryanair the establishment of a facility at Shannon Airport. Having done so, on 18 February 2010, Mr. O'Leary responded indicating that Ryanair had no such requirements at Shannon. The issue of airline routes and scheduling is a matter for the Minister for Transport.
